Design Freak
Jun 20, 2012, 10:57 AM
Use a ledger and the adjacent walls if there are any.
If not use strapping. This application is acceptable as long as due diligance has been performed to ensure.
1) the beam that the landing is bieng suspended from is capable of accepting the additional load.
2) the nailing requirements for the strap(s) are followed for the applied loads. (Be very conservative!)
3) Use engineered wood products(LVL ) to further help the cause, as LVL can handle higher loading and performs better all around vs. conventional lumber.
